A Russian cargo ship 'Ursa Major' sank in the Mediterranean Sea between Spain and Algeria. 14 members on board were rescued safely. Two members are still reported to be missing. A big conspiracy is being said to be behind the sinking of this cargo ship. Oboronlogistica company claims that terrorists are behind this incident. However, they have not named anyone in this regard.
The company claimed that some conspiracy was hatched against that ship in the sea itself. Due to which it sank. The reason behind this, they told, was that before the cargo ship sank, there were 3 explosions in it. Later there was an explosion near the engine and the ship sank. Terrorists have a hand in these explosions.
However, the reason for the explosion could not be ascertained. We are currently in touch with various agencies and trying to find out the reasons for the sinking of the ship. The Maritime Transport Department has started investigating this entire matter.

Spain's maritime rescue service said in a statement, the ship made an emergency call off the coast of south-eastern Spain in bad weather on Monday morning. In which they asked for a life support boat. After which helicopters and boats were sent for their help. The people on board the ship were taken to a safe place. 2 people are still missing. The Russian Foreign Ministry said that the ship is owned by a subsidiary of Russia's Oboronlogistica, which belongs to the Ministry of Defense.
Ursa Major landed in the sea in 2009
The Ursa Major, which had a capacity of 1,200 tonnes and could fit 120 vehicles on its deck, was the largest cargo ship operated by Oboronlogistika, a company affiliated with the Russian Defence Ministry, which transports military and civilian goods, according to the company's website. The ship was put to sea in 2009.
